Diane I too will be at the beach and I am sooooo looking forward to the time away!

As you all know I am 13 days post op, and I have been reading about band slippage. I am not eating what I shouldnt but am worried when I eat mushies and then progress onto solids that it will slip. If it does slip will you know it? Did any of you have that concern? I have read of folks who didnt follow the diet or was told by their DR that they could eat solids earlier and they seem to be doing well. Did you all stray or were you all compliant with the DR orders?

I hope everyone has a great Thanksgiving!:grouphug:

It is beautiful in Gulf Shores this morning! Happy Thanksgiving.

I think slippage is pretty rare, actually, but from what I've learned , it's most definitely caused by misbehaving! Eating solids too soon can cause your pouch to stretch before it is fully healed from surgery. I've read alot about what other doctors suggest here, and of course they are all different, but I stuck with what our drs recommended. Seems like Veronica has said, they have only seen two slippages (or it was a very low number anyway) so I feel they are offering sound advice. I have to say it boggles my mind, so many people in other forums here don't have a clue what they are supposed to be eating, etc. Evidently our docs are very good with education, as well.
